The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
At the heart of every reputable online casino lies the Random Number Generator (RNG). This is a crucial piece of software that ensures the fairness and impartiality of game outcomes. RNGs are complex algorithms designed to produce sequences of numbers that are statistically random, meaning that each number has an equal chance of being selected. These numbers then determine the results of games like slots, roulette, and blackjack. Independent auditing firms regularly test RNGs to verify their integrity and ensure they are not rigged or predictable. The reliability of the RNG is paramount to maintaining player trust and upholding the legitimacy of the online casino. Without a trustworthy RNG, the concept of a fair game quickly dissolves, and the entire industry suffers a blow to its reputation. Transparency regarding RNG certification is a key indicator of a trustworthy gaming platform.

Navigating the Landscape of Online Casino Bonuses
One of the most attractive aspects of online casinos is the availability of bonuses and promotions. These incentives are designed to attract new players and reward existing ones, offering a boost to their bankrolls and extending their playtime. However, it’s essential to understand the terms and conditions associated with these bonuses, as they often come with certain requirements, such as wagering requirements and game restrictions. A wagering requirement dictates how much a player must wager before being able to withdraw any winnings earned from the bonus. Game restrictions may limit the types of games that contribute towards meeting these requirements. Failing to carefully review these terms can lead to frustration and disappointment when attempting to cash out winnings. A thorough understanding of bonus structures is crucial for maximizing their benefits and avoiding potential pitfalls.
Types of Common Casino Bonuses
The world of casino bonuses is diverse, with various types tailored to different player preferences and gaming habits. Welcome bonuses are typically offered to new players upon their first deposit, often matching a percentage of the deposit amount. Deposit bonuses are ongoing incentives awarded for subsequent deposits, providing a continued boost to a player's funds. Free spins are another popular bonus, allowing players to spin the reels of a slot machine without using their own money. No-deposit bonuses, while rarer, offer a small amount of credit simply for registering an account, allowing players to try out the casino without any financial commitment. Each bonus type has its own set of conditions, so it's always advisable to read the fine print before claiming any offer. Ensuring Security and Responsible Gaming
In the digital age, security is paramount, especially when it comes to financial transactions. Reputable online casinos utilize advanced encryption technology,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to protect players' personal and financial information. They also implement robust security measures to prevent fraud and unauthorized access. Before depositing any funds, it's essential to verify that the casino is licensed and regulated by a reputable gaming authority. These authorities oversee the casino's operations, ensuring fairness and compliance with industry standards. Look for licensing information prominently displayed on the casino's website. Furthermore, promoting responsible gaming practices is a critical aspect of a reputable online casino. This includes providing t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ations. A responsible casino prioritizes player well-being and promotes a safe gaming environment.
Recognizing and Addressing Problem Gambling
While online casinos offer entertainment and potential rewards, it’s crucial to be aware of the risks associated with problem gambling. Problem gambling, also known as gambling addiction, is a serious condition that can have devastating consequences for individuals and their families. Symptoms include an uncontrollable urge to gamble, chasing losses, lying about gambling habits, and neglecting personal responsibilities.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, it's essential to seek help. Numerous organizations offer support and resources for individuals affected by gambling addiction. These resources include counseling services, support groups, and self-help materials. Remember, seeking help is a sign of strength, and recovery is possible. The Expanding Role of Live Dealer Games
Live dealer games represent a fascinating intersection between the convenience of online gaming and the authenticity of a traditional casino experience. These games feature real human dealers who interact with players via live video streams, creating a more immersive and engaging atmosphere. Players can participate in games like blackjack, roulette, and baccarat from the comfort of their own homes, while still enjoying the social interaction and excitement of a real casino. The quality of live streams has significantly improved in recent years, with high-definition video and interactive features enhancing the overall experience.
